Odometer Question

Lets say you switched an engine from a '95 Caprice to a '94 Caprice. Would the milage reading from the '95 engine be shown on the '94 (electronic dash)or would the '94 still show the miles of its old engine?

Not correct, the mileage is stored in the speedometer. In fact the chip can be changed when they are repaired, BTW then the speedo reads 00000 as if it was new.
